Flat roofs are The only, speediest, and minimum expensive to assemble but is often a lot more high-priced to keep up. It truly is important to produce a slight pitch to the drainage of rainfall.

A sloped roof adds temperament and interest to an normally really boxy house. Additionally, it serves two simple purposes. It helps prevent h2o and debris from accumulating over the flat prime within your container. In addition, it means that you can situation your property and roof to make the most of photo voltaic panels or skylights.

What this means is wherever you cut out a significant window, or doorway opening calls for new reinforcement. And when they are stacked jointly to generate greater homes, welded (high priced) reinforcement is needed where ever two containers be a part of in a location that is not a corner. Any later on renovations call for major engineering and welding.

There's two typical methods people create a two-story home outside of two delivery containers. They both stack one particular along with one other going through the same way, or they switch the very best 1 ninety levels. In any case, you could generate extra dwelling space or greater ceilings.
